Let’s stop Stephen Harper

October 9, 2008

It’s pretty hard to forget Mike Harris, the former Ontario Premier who left scars on this province that still haven’t healed.

Now his political twin, Stephen Harper, is our Prime Minister. Like Harris, Harper is all about cutting taxes. Cutting taxes is his answer to everything.

But cutting taxes won’t bring back the 400,000 manufacturing jobs we’ve lost. Cutting taxes won’t address climate change. Cutting taxes won’t create more childcare spaces, or shorten hospital wait times, or reduce poverty.

Without taxes, government can’t work. And it certainly can’t help people.

The Stephen Harper you see on TV is not the real Harper. Not long ago, he was president of the National Citizens’ Coalition, an extreme-right-wing lobby group. The NCC has called for the “de-unionization” of Canada, the privatization of public services, and massive cuts to human rights, women’s groups, culture, and public sector jobs.

I strongly urge you to learn more about Harper’s political beliefs. You can download The Harper Record for free from the Canadian Centre for Policy Alternatives. I also like The Harper Index, a web site devoted to helping Canadians know the real man.

The world is in a crisis right now, and we don’t know what will happen next. Now more than ever, Canada needs an activist government that will invest in infrastructure and jobs and shelter people from the worst of the current economic storm. We don’t need Stephen Harper.

The OPSEU Executive Board urges you to cast your vote to defeat Harper and his Conservatives. To do this, we need to vote smart.

It is crucial that you make your decision based on the situation in your own riding. Under our system, we’re not having one election on Oct. 14, we’re having 308 separate elections. It’s your riding that matters.

So, how do you find out about the political lay of the land in your riding? The Elections Canada web site has results from the last election. Another good site is electionprediction.org, a project started by the Political Science department at the University of Waterloo. Probably the best is voteforenvironment.ca , sponsored by environmental activists. The goal of the site is to stop Harper by voting smart. That’s our goal, too.

I hope you have a great Thanksgiving weekend. On Tuesday, Oct. 14, let’s stop Stephen Harper.
